Job Description

An employer in the Dayton, OH, area is seeking a TS/SCI Model Based System Engineer for a contract to hire opportunity. This individual will be responsible but not limited to the following: Will focus on developing and applying digital system models to analyze foreign space systems, support threat assessments, and enhance mission planning. The MBSE Engineer will collaborate with multidisciplinary teams to visualize complex architectures, ensure data traceability, and contribute to predictive intelligence efforts in a mission-critical environment. Will be required to sit on site at the base and have an active TS/SCI Security clearance.

Required Skills & Experience

Active TS/SCI Security clearance
Bachelor’s Degree (STEM related)
At least 5+ years of Model Based Systems Engineering experience
Experience using Cameo or MagicDraw
Proven ability to comprehend/develop/decompose System Architecture/Requirements (from System Specifications high-level requirements to the lowest level) in a model-based environment
Experience interfacing with customers, subject matter experts, analysts, architects, designers, system engineers and specialty engineers to capture.

Nice to Have Skills & Experience

Master’s Degree
Experience using AFSIM
